River rescues
The Cass County Sheriff’s Department, U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service and the U.S. Coast Guard are now conducting river rescues along the Heritage Hills-Oxbow, N.D., corridor including the Butcher Block subdivision. This area is dangerous as river water are rapidly rising. Residents … Continue reading
